Description: Linguistics is the scientific study of all forms of human language. It is a search for the patterns of sound, word-form, phrase structure and meaning that underlie the languages we use. The linguistics program is taught by faculty members in a variety of areas within the University. The Department of Indian Languages, Literatures, and Linguistics, SIFC (including the three full-time Linguistics faculty) offers a large number of courses; other linguistics courses are offered by the Faculties of Arts and Education.
